      [SCSI] FC Pass Thru support · 9e4f5e29
      James Smart 提交于
      Attached is the ELS/CT pass-thru patch for the FC Transport. The patch
      creates a generic framework that lays on top of bsg and the SGIO v4 ioctl
      in order to pass transaction requests to LLDD's.
      
      The interface supports the following operations:
        On an fc_host basis:
          Request login to the specified N_Port_ID, creating an fc_rport.
          Request logout of the specified N_Port_ID, deleting an fc_rport
          Send ELS request to specified N_Port_ID w/o requiring a login, and
            wait for ELS response.
          Send CT request to specified N_Port_ID and wait for CT response.
            Login is required, but LLDD is allowed to manage login and decide
            whether it stays in place after the request is satisfied.
          Vendor-Unique request. Allows a LLDD-specific request to be passed
            to the LLDD, and the passing of a response back to the application.
        On an fc_rport basis:
          Send ELS request to nport and wait for ELS response.
          Send CT request to nport and wait for CT response.
      
      The patch also exports several headers from include/scsi such that
      they can be available to user-space applications:
        include/scsi/scsi.h
        include/scsi/scsi_netlink.h
        include/scsi/scsi_netlink_fc.h
        include/scsi/scsi_bsg_fc.h
      
      For further information, refer to the last RFC:
      http://marc.info/?l=linux-scsi&m=123436574018579&w=2
      
      Note: Documentation is still spotty and will be added later.

      fcoe: adds spma mode support · 184dd345
      Vasu Dev 提交于
      If we can find a type NETDEV_HW_ADDR_T_SAN mac address from the
      corresponding netdev for a fcoe interface then sets up added the
      fc->ctlr.spma flag and stores spma mode address in ctl_src_addr.
      
      In case the spma flag is set then:-
      
       1. Adds spma mode MAC address in ctl_src_addr as secondary
          MAC address, the FLOGI for FIP and pre-FIP will go out
          using this address.
       2. Cleans up stored spma MAC address in ctl_src_addr in
          fcoe_netdev_cleanup.
       3. Sets up spma bit in fip_flags for FIP solicitations along
          with exiting FPMA bit setting.
       4. Initialize the FLOGI FIP MAC descriptor to stored spma
          MAC address in ctl_src_addr. This is used as proposed
          FCoE MAC address from initiator along with both SPMA
          and FPMA bit set in FIP solicitation, in response the
          switch may grant any FPMA or SPMA mode MAC address to
          initiator.
      
      Removes FIP descriptor type checking against ELS type
      ELS_FLOGI in fcoe_ctlr_encaps to update a FIP MAC descriptor,
      instead now checks against FIP_DT_FLOGI.
      
      I've tested this with available FPMA-only FCoE switch but
      since data_src_addr is updated using same old code for
      both FPMA and SPMA modes with FIP or pre-FIP links, so added
      SPMA mode will work with SPMA-only switch also provided that
      switch grants a valid MAC address.

      [SCSI] fc-transport: Close state transition-window during rport deletion. · 9a1a69a1
      Andrew Vasquez 提交于
      Andrew Vasquez wrote:
      > fc-transport: Close state transition-window during rport deletion.
      >
      > After an rport's state has transitioned to FC_PORTSTATE_BLOCKED,
      > but, prior to making the upcall to 'block' the scsi-target
      > associated with an rport, queued commands can recycle and
      > ultimately run out of retries causing failures to propagate to
      > upper-level drivers.  Close this transition-window by returning
      > the non-'retries' modifying DID_IMM_RETRY status for submitted
      > I/Os.
      
      The same can happen for iscsi when transitioning from logged in
      to failed and blocking the sdevs.
      
      This patch converts iscsi and fc's transitions back to use DID_IMM_RETRY
      instead of DID_TRANSPORT_DISRUPTED which has a limited number of retries
      that we do not want to use for handling this race.

      block: convert to pos and nr_sectors accessors · 83096ebf
      Tejun Heo 提交于
      With recent cleanups, there is no place where low level driver
      directly manipulates request fields.  This means that the 'hard'
      request fields always equal the !hard fields.  Convert all
      rq->sectors, nr_sectors and current_nr_sectors references to
      accessors.
      
      While at it, drop superflous blk_rq_pos() < 0 test in swim.c.

      [SCSI] libfc: Fix compilation warnings with allmodconfig · a29e7646
      Robert Love 提交于
      When building with a .config generated from 'make allmodconfig'
      some build warnings are generated. This patch corrects the warnings,
      adds a FC_FID_NONE (= 0) enumeration for FC-IDs and cleans up one
      variable naming to meet our variable naming conventions. For example,
      fc_lport's should be named "lport," not "lp."

      [SCSI] libfc: Track rogue remote ports · b4c6f546
      Abhijeet Joglekar 提交于
      Rogue ports are currently not tracked on any list. The only reference
      to them is through any outstanding exchanges pending on the rogue ports.
      If the module is removed while a retry is set on a rogue port
      (say a Plogi retry for instance), this retry is not cancelled because there
      is no reference to the rogue port in the discovery rports list. Thus the
      local port can clean itself up, delete the exchange pool, and then the
      rogue port timeout can fire and try to start up another exchange.
      
      This patch tracks the rogue ports in a new list disc->rogue_rports. Creating
      a new list instead of using the disc->rports list keeps remote port code
      change to a minimum.
      
      1)  Whenever a rogue port is created, it is immediately added to the
      disc->rogue_rports list.
      
      2) When the rogues port goes to ready, it is removed from the rogue list
      and the real remote port is added to the disc->rports list
      
      3) The removal of the rogue from the disc->rogue_rports list is done in
      the context of the fc_rport_work() workQ thread in discovery callback.
      
      4) Real rports are removed from the disc->rports list like before. Lookup
      is done only in the real rports list. This avoids making large changes
      to the remote port code.
      
      5) In fc_disc_stop_rports, the rogues list is traversed in addition to the
      real list to stop the rogue ports and issue logoffs on them. This way, rogue
      ports get cleaned up when the local port goes away.
      
      6) rogue remote ports are not removed from the list right away, but
      removed late in fc_rport_work() context, multiple threads can find the same
      remote port in the list and call rport_logoff(). Rport_logoff() only
      continues with the logoff if port is not in NONE state, thus preventing
      multiple logoffs and multiple list deletions.
      
      7) Since the rport is removed from the disc list at a later stage
      (in the disc callback), incoming frames can find the rport even if
      rport_logoff() has been called on the rport. When rport_logoff() is called,
      the rport state is set to NONE, and we are trying to cancel all exchanges
      and retries on that port. While in this state, if an incoming
      Plogi/Prli/Logo or other frames match the rport, we should not reply
      because the rport is in the NONE state. Just drop the frame, since the
      rport will be deleted soon in the disc callback (fc_rport_work)
      
      8)  In fc_disc_single(), remove rport lookup and call to fc_disc_del_target.
      fc_disc_single() is called from recv_rscn_req() where rport lookup
      and rport_logoff is already done.

      [SCSI] cxgb3i, iser, iscsi_tcp: set target can queue · 6b5d6c44
      Mike Christie 提交于
      Set target can queue limit to the number of preallocated
      session tasks we have.
      
      This along with the cxgb3i can_queue patch will fix a throughput
      problem where it could only queue one LU worth of data at a time.
